  • Overview

    Based on an analysis of the Internet’s development trends and subversive impact on Internet business model, Internet Finance delves into the operational structure, survival logic, theoretical foundation, and risk profile of Internet finance. It also outlines the boundary of substitution between Internet finance and traditional finance, and comes up with cornerstone regulatory guidelines for Internet finance.

    Internet Finance argues that Internet finance is the third form of finance, and is the first one to claim that Internet finance is the “second disintermediation” of traditional finance. In addition, the author systematically expounds the theoretical structure of Internet finance and explores the cornerstone regulatory standards for Internet finance.The book is the author’s theoretical reflection about Internet finance rather than an explanation of practical problems.
